    Erik Daniel Pappas (born April 25, 1966) is an American former professional baseball player and coach. He played as a catcher in Major League Baseball for the Chicago Cubs and St. Louis Cardinals .

    Natalia Esquivel Benítez (born 15 December 1973 in San José) is a Costa Rican composer, guitarist, singer-songwriter, author, poet, vocalist and academic.. Esquivel studied musical education at the National University of Costa Rica; further she obtained a master degree at the Indiana University of Pennsylvania.

    Rikkoi Brathwaite (born 13 February 1999) is a sprinter from the British Virgin Islands.He is national champion and national record holder over 100 metres.. Career. From Tortola, Brathwaite ran for the University of Indiana and finished second at the 2022 NCAA Indoor Championships over 60 metres running a personal best time of 6.52 seconds in Birmingham, Alabama.

' "Marius" is a science fiction short story by American writer Poul Anderson, first published in the March 1957 issue of Astounding Science Fiction and reprinted in the collections The Horn of Time (1968) and The Psychotechnic League (1981).     Christos Pappas (Greek: Χρήστος Παππάς; born 1962, Athens) is a Greek politician, convicted criminal and a former deputy leader of the Greek Parliament for the neo-Nazi Golden Dawn party.
